如何编写高效的测试用例报告,提升软件质量?

测试用例报告的重要性及基本要素

测试用例报告是软件测试过程中不可或缺的环节,它直接影响着项目质量和开发进度。一份高质量的测试用例报告不仅能够清晰地展示测试结果,还能为开发团队提供有价值的反馈,从而不断优化产品。本文将深入探讨如何编写高效的测试用例报告,以及如何通过优质报告提升软件质量。

测试用例报告的结构设计

一份完整的测试用例报告通常包含以下几个关键部分:

1. 测试概述:简要说明测试目的、范围和测试环境。

2. 测试用例详情:列出每个测试用例的具体信息,包括用例ID、描述、预期结果和实际结果。

3. 测试执行情况:记录测试过程中的观察结果,包括通过、失败或阻塞的用例数量。

4. 缺陷报告:详细描述发现的问题,包括缺陷的严重程度、复现步骤等。

5. 结论和建议:总结测试结果,提出改进建议。

在设计报告结构时,可以使用ONES研发管理平台提供的测试报告模板,它能够帮助测试人员快速创建规范的报告结构,提高工作效率。

测试用例报告的编写技巧

要编写一份高效的测试用例报告,需要注意以下几点:

1. 清晰简洁:使用简洁明了的语言描述测试过程和结果,避免冗长和模糊的表述。

2. 重点突出:将重要的测试结果和关键问题放在报告的显著位置,便于阅读者快速抓住重点。

3. 数据支持:尽可能提供具体的数据和统计信息,如测试覆盖率、缺陷密度等,以增加报告的说服力。

4. 逻辑性强:按照测试的执行顺序或重要程度组织报告内容,确保报告结构清晰、逻辑连贯。

5. 可追溯性:为每个测试用例和发现的缺陷分配唯一标识符,便于后续跟踪和管理。

使用ONES研发管理平台的测试管理功能,可以轻松记录和管理测试用例,自动生成测试报告,大大提高测试报告的编写效率和质量。

测试用例报告

提升软件质量的测试报告策略

高质量的测试用例报告不仅能反映软件的当前状态,还能为持续改进提供依据。以下策略可以帮助通过测试报告提升软件质量:

1. 深入分析根本原因:对于发现的缺陷,不仅要描述现象,还要尽可能分析问题的根本原因,为开发团队提供有价值的信息。

2. 提供改进建议:基于测试结果,提出具体可行的改进建议,帮助开发团队优化代码质量和开发流程。

3. 跟踪历史趋势:对比不同版本的测试报告,分析软件质量的变化趋势,及时发现潜在的质量问题。

4. 关注用户体验:在报告中强调对用户体验有重大影响的问题,确保产品能够满足用户需求。

5. 促进团队协作:通过测试报告促进测试、开发和产品团队之间的沟通,共同解决问题,提升软件质量。

ONES研发管理平台提供了全面的项目管理和协作功能,能够帮助团队更好地实施这些策略,实现测试报告与开发流程的无缝集成。

测试用例报告的自动化与优化

随着软件开发规模的扩大和迭代速度的加快,手动编写测试用例报告可能会成为效率瓶颈。因此,引入自动化工具和优化流程变得至关重要:

1. 自动化测试报告生成:利用自动化测试工具,可以在测试执行后自动生成初步的测试报告,大大节省人力成本。

2. 数据可视化:使用图表和仪表盘等可视化工具,直观地展示测试结果和质量指标。

3. 实时更新:采用持续集成/持续部署(CI/CD)流程,实现测试报告的实时更新,及时反映软件的最新状态。

4. 智能分析:引入人工智能技术,对测试数据进行智能分析,自动识别潜在的质量风险。

5. 标准化模板:制定统一的测试报告模板,确保报告的一致性和可比性。

ONES研发管理平台提供了强大的自动化测试和报告生成功能,可以帮助团队轻松实现测试报告的自动化和优化,提高测试效率和报告质量。

结语

高效的测试用例报告是提升软件质量的重要工具。通过精心设计报告结构、运用有效的编写技巧、实施质量提升策略以及引入自动化工具,我们可以显著提高测试报告的价值,从而推动整个软件开发过程的质量提升。在这个过程中,选择合适的研发管理工具至关重要。通过持续优化测试用例报告的编写和管理流程,我们能够更好地识别和解决软件问题,最终交付高质量的产品,满足用户需求,提升企业竞争力。